The transmission line which is the intermediate link of electrical energy delivery plays an important role in construction and operation of power industry. However, As it often exposure in harsh natural environment and also it is widespread, the trasmission line is destined to suffer fault. Based on this situation, in order to ensure the reliability of power supply and reduce the outage cost, the State Grid Corporation of China(SGCC) has been put varieties of monitoring systems for real-time information collection. The functional requirements and data format may not the same as these monitoring systems are developed by different manufacturers in different periods.However, these information from different system has certain relationship, therefore, there is a need for integration of historical data and real-time data from the grid. Multi-source data of fault diagnosis methods and data mining technology has been mature which provides theoretical support and demand to establish a data warehouse. This thesis in such demand, has done the follwing research.Firstly, this thesis discussed the necessity of using software platform for manage multi-source fault data in transmission line. From the perspective of software design, this thesis designed the physical model and time granularity also the fact table and every dimension table.in order to ensure the data of the data warehouse updated in real time, and solve the disorderly phenomenon which multi-source’s data bring in, this thesis uses the incremental extraction rules based on the trigger to update the data,at the same time, it also pays attention to data preprocessing, which removes the redundant data and duplicate data and error data to ensure that the data in the warehouse is clean.Secondly, consider the possibility of the line alarm may be inaccurate and the channel may break, this thesis has concluded the judgment rule of real fault data after extraction the multi-source data. Through testing the actual data of power grid, it verified the feasibility and accuracy of the data warehouse.Finally, using the data warehouse which has been set up, combining with the characteristics of transmission line fault cases current rate of change, this thesis completed the quick access to information for fault diagnosis research; On this basis, this thesis inserted the subjective fault cause data to spatial statistical analysis for 500kV lines’fault in a province grid using the query function module.Practice has proved, the data warehouse made by this thesis has a certain accuracy and reliability, it will provide the data preparation for fault diagnosis and data mining work, and it has a certain practical significance and research value.
